Motorola RAZR V3x Review (Expert)
The model has no problems with the connection quality being a typical modern device. Musical component is on the triplet's level, mp3 play back is present and limitations are not as strict. Signal volume is higher than average, Midi-files are played in the 64-tones polyphony that sound well also. The vibra is average or a bit more powerful. The loudspeaker volume is enough during a conversation almost always. Due to the shortage of chipsets EDGE is not provided in the first shipped phones. And the company plans to solve the problem only in spring 2006. The second disadvantage is GoForce 4200 works only when the camera works. The developers had no time to finish the software, and as a result the graphical accelerator is used nowhere. On the other hand the company placed no emphasis on it when introducing the phone, so, everything is fair. Later the maker plans to realize a full support for the graphical chip, which will provide higher performance both in 2D and 3D applications. People who already bought the model will have problems with renewing the software and turning the accelerator. Considering how slow the company develops software, we can suppose that the renewal of this model with independent voice recognition, a fully-functional GoForce and some functional improvements will appear in the beginning of the summer 2006. That is why Motorola V3x is only an intermediate solution, a kind of a test sample to test technologies and new applications. Despite it all the model is interesting as a cheap UMTS solution. Without a contract the price forms 450-500 USD, and in the beginning of March retail price will form 350-400 USD. This handset is interesting for the general functionality, a good screen, the absence of direct rivals. Siemens SXG75 could pretend on this role if it were modern but not a previous generation phone. Direct comparison of these two phones and their functions revealed that the Siemens' product lost even at a higher price. You shouldn't wait for this model, though it tries to play on the same field as Motorola V3x. The V3x will have moderate sales on open non-operator markets, and nevertheless future models based on this phone will be of greater interest.
Motorola's RAZR was a vast worldwide hit thanks to its undeniably sharp design, but those that delved deeper than the superficiality of its look found the specifications somewhat lacking. RAZR V3x, a 3G variant with generally improved specifications all round. Fatter than the original RAZR, but remains Motorola's thinnest 3G handset to date. In one way, Motorola has done itself proud in using a single mini-USB connector for mains power, headphones and connecting to a PC. As far as the rest of the edges of the RAZR V3x are concerned, there are a couple of buttons on both left and right. These buttons are all pretty sensitive, and unfortunately we found ourselves accidentally hitting the voice command button when picking the phone up, which was irritating. At least all bar the camera button are inactive when the clamshell is closed. One of the things Motorola is emphasising with the RAZR V3x is its surround sound. You won't get to appreciate this through the single speaker on the back of the handset, which outputs to a reasonable volume but doesn't deliver much by way of depth. The 2-megapixel camera shot images of decent quality. Colours weren't quite a sharp as we'd like, but we've definitely seen worse. You won't get a huge amount of life out of the battery as Motorola's suggestion of 99 minutes of video talk from a full charge indicates. But as the RAZR V3x is not really intended as a full-frontal music player, and assuming you aren't going to want to make lengthy video calls every day, you should be able to get by for a couple of days between charges.
